Position Overview

 

The Head Start teacher instructs, nurtures, and encourages Head Start preschool children to increase their social competency,  and guides students toward the fulfillment of their potential for social, emotional, psychological, and intellectual growth.

 

PRIMARY R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Meet and instruct assigned class in the location and at the times designated; develop and maintain a classroom environment conducive to effective learning and strives to establish positive relations with families; prepare lesson plans with assistant teacher, post plans and provide copies to the Education Coordinator; encourage students to create and maintain appropriate standards of classroom behavior
  • Strive to implement by instruction and action the district’s philosophy of education and instructional goals, the objectives of Head Start, and the HighScope curriculum
  • Take all necessary and reasonable precautions to protect students, equipment, materials, and facilities
  • Evaluate student progress using required screenings and assessments within specific timelines; maintain accurate and complete records
  • Make provisions for being available to students and families for education-related purposes outside of the instructional day when required or requested to do so under reasonable terms
  • Work to establish and maintain open lines of communication with students and their families regarding both the academic and behavioral progress of all assigned students
  • Participate with assistant teacher in Home Visits and Parent/Teacher Conferences with Head Start families
  • Attend and participate in Head Start staff meetings and professional development
  • Meet Head Start requirements by sharing responsibility with a multi-disciplinary team
  • Participate in family style meals with students by sharing the same menu to the fullest extent possible

 

QUALIFICATIONS:

  • Hold a minimum of Bachelor's degree in Early Childhood Education; Master's degree preferred
  • Must hold or qualify for a Collegiate or Postgraduate Commonwealth of Virginia Professional License with an Early/Primary Education Pre-K-3 Endorsement
  • Experience working with preschool age children
  • Demonstrate effective oral and written communication skills and strong organizational skills
  • Bi-lingual preferred, but not required

 

ORGANIZATIONAL RELATIONSHIP:

The Head Start Teacher is directly responsible to the Head Start and STEP Supervisor.

About Loudoun County Public Schools (Virginia)

Loudoun County Public Schools (LCPS) fulfills its mission of “Empowering all students to make meaningful contributions to the world" through deeper learning experiences, demonstrating instructional leadership across the Commonwealth and nation as a member of the Virginia is for Lovers Network 4.0 and by being recognized by the Virginia Department of Education as a School Division of Innovation.

Loudoun's 98 public schools offer more than 82,000 students an educational program that ranks among the best in Virginia and the nation.  As the fastest growing county in the Commonwealth of Virginia, Loudoun continues its proud tradition of quality public education, maintaining an outstanding record of student achievement despite the pressures of surging enrollment.

Loudoun County Public Schools is the third largest school division in the Commonwealth of Virginia and the 41st in the nation.
